How do you get around Hawaii without a car on the Big Island?

The public (Hele-on) bus service is an alternative if you have plenty of time and want to avoid renting a car. The cheapest way to get around the Big Island after walking yourself is the public bus (Hele-on-Bus). This bus will get you to most places on the island, but transit times are long and connections infrequent.

Why does Enterprise have no cars available?

That is because the shortage of semiconductor chips that has held up auto manufacturing persists, leaving rental car companies to operate with lower inventory after they sold off chunks of their fleets in the early days of the pandemic. Building that stock back up has been more difficult than expected.

Why is there a rental car shortage right now?

The problem is that production of less expensive cars ($25,000 or less) has suffered due to the chip shortage, and cars currently in rental fleets are largely leftovers from before the pandemic arrived. Many of them were also sold during the summer of 2020 as rental companies moved to reduce their fleets.

How much is Uber from airport to Waikiki?

Rideshare. Both Uber and Lyft are allowed to pick up and drop off airport passengers at HNL. Two pick-up locations are available on-site: outside Lobby 2 and outside Lobby 8. The TNC fares for a ride from Honolulu Airport to Waikiki start at $25.

How much does it cost to go from Honolulu airport to Waikiki?

$40-45 USD
The easiest and most convenient way to get from Honolulu airport to Waikiki is by taking a taxi or a private Honolulu airport shuttle. The journey only takes 15 minutes for the total cost of $40-45 USD (€33.50-37.50) if you take a metered taxi or $38 (€32) if you take a private shuttle.
